About this role
The Casino Service Technician performs preventive maintenance and troubleshooting/repairs for casino gaming equipment across a designated territory. The role includes documenting incidents and maintaining technical logs while serving as a primary customer point of contact.
Key Responsibilities
- Perform preventive maintenance on EGMs
- Troubleshoot and repair games and associated systems
- Install, configure, troubleshoot, and update products at casino locations
- Document incident reports and maintain maintenance records
- Update and manage daily/weekly technical logs
Technical Overview
Technician responsibilities center on Electronic Gaming Machines (EGMs), including diagnostic exams, software configurations, hands-on testing, and repairing games and associated systems. The role also requires disciplined incident reporting and maintenance recordkeeping via daily/weekly technical logs.
